Popularity and Accessibility:
One of many reasons behind the immense popularity of online poker is its availability. People can log on to their most favorite on-line poker systems at any time, from everywhere, employing their computer systems or mobile devices. This convenience features drawn a varied player base, ranging from leisure players to experts, contributing to the rapid growth of on-line poker.

Benefits of Online Poker:
On-line poker provides a number of benefits over traditional brick-and-mortar casinos. Firstly, it offers a wider range of game options, including different poker alternatives and stakes, catering into the choices and spending plans of types of players. Furthermore, on-line poker spaces tend to be open 24/7, getting rid of the constraints of physical casino running hours. In addition, on the web systems often provide attractive incentives, commitment programs, as well as the capability to play several tables at the same time, improving the entire video gaming experience.

Challenges and Regulation:
While the internet poker business flourishes, it deals with challenges in the form of regulation and security problems. Governing bodies worldwide have actually implemented differing levels of regulation to protect players and give a wide berth to fraudulent tasks. Additionally, internet poker systems need sturdy safety steps to safeguard people' personal and monetary information, ensuring a safe playing environment.

Financial and Personal Influence:
The rise of online poker has already established a significant financial effect globally. Online poker systems generate considerable revenue through rake fees, event entry charges, and marketing. This revenue has generated task creation and investments into the gaming business. Additionally, internet poker has actually contributed to an increase in tax revenue for governments in which it really is controlled, supporting general public solutions.

From a personal viewpoint, internet poker has actually fostered a global poker community, bridging geographical barriers. People from diverse experiences and locations can communicate and compete, fostering a sense of camaraderie. Internet poker has additionally played a vital role to advertise the video game's popularity and attracting brand new people, causing the expansion of this poker business as a whole.
